WebApr 27, 2024 · The UK has adopted ambitious tree planting targets but we are starting from a very low base. We are a deforested country with a tree cover of approximately one third of the European average. As a consequence, the UK is the second largest importer of wood products in the World after China. WebThe reforesting Scotland project aims to restore a diversify of woodland types to Scotland, prioritising the pinewood and riparian woodland habitats. Scots pine and downy birch saplings, alongside a diversity of food-producing broadleaf trees, such as hazel and bird cherry, are being planted across the valley bottoms and hillsides, while alders ...
